Remember that time George Clooney got a pig? We have all seen the videos, the tik tok’s, Instagram posts and celebs flaunting their teacup babies, but are there consequences to this new mad craze? Local vegan vet, Agustin Gonzalez knows all too well the trouble it has caused. A few Vietnamese pigs were bought and exported to Mijas, Andalucía Spain to be kept as cute pets.
